Toyota Corolla Ad Shows Why You Should Elevate Your Drive

Automakers nowadays are far from simply advertising a car. Now, customers have to find themselves in the ad, to recognize the characters as if it were them starring in the commercial. That’s pretty much Toyota’s new plan of making people buy their new Corolla.
And when you’re young and reckless, where do you most likely see yourself? Sloppy and low on cash, of course. And that means you’re driving a car worthy of almost zero respect. The looks are so bad, you don’t even have a rightful name for it. You eat in the car, wash it only when it rains and treat it like you’d handle the neighborhood’s stray dog. So far so good, right?

But then Toyota shows the same you some years later, when you presumably have made something out of your studying years and now can afford a better car. A new, shiny car, that is... well, the 2015 Toyota Corolla, of course.

These days, you’re not allowing your college friend to eat in the car, stickers are not to be put on the bumper anymore and taking the car to a new wash is something that gives you shivers.

The rest of the story is pretty much highlighted in the video below which, by the way, seems to be some sort of collaboration between Toyota and BuzzFeed. Is it weird? Nope. In fact, the two have been collaborating before. It was about two years ago when the social media channel has worked for about a month with the Japanese to promote the Toyota Prius c small hybrid car.

Sure, the Corolla isn't exactly the American dream, but then again, this is a Toyota ad, so what did you expect?
